If you are moving to a home that is the exact same style as the home you now have, you can make it faster to furnish your new home by taking up parts of your decor as "coalesced objects".  I generally do that room-by-room and put all the coalesced objects in a single folder titled something like  "FURNISH Belli Trad Winchester <region name>".  You don't really want to take ALL of your stuff as a single coalesced object, because when you go to rez it again, it probably will go over the border of your parcel, and either not rez at all or only some of the items will rez.

Another approach is to put it all in a rezzer (if it's all copiable), but that involves putting a script in each linkset, so unless you've linked most of the stuff already to each other, that's time consuming.

But if you're going to get a different style home, no, you just pick it all up, or delete it, piece by piece, AFAIK.

------

Basically to get a new home, you just first abandon your current one.  If you don't pick up your stuff first, it will be returned to whoever owns it as a single coalesced object, which is messy to sort out, and risky if you have nocopy items.

Then, as a premium plus member, you have two options to get a new home.

1.  Select a new home that you really like and submit a ticket to support to get it allocated to you.  It must be in a region that is released (region name does not start with SSP), and must not belong to someone else (check the land menu!).  OR

2.  Log into the land page on the website, choose the theme you're most interested in, and the land page will give you a random parcel in that theme.  NOTE: if you don't see the theme you're interested in, check the last page - themes that currently have no open parcels are listed last.  You can do this 5 times within 24 hours.

if you have just gone premium plus, you most likely want to move from your previous belli home to either a Ranch or a Mediterranean. In either case, the houses are different than whatever you had as a premium member. Your best bet is to pick up furniture room by room, and maybe put each room in a separate subfolder so you  can easily find it to arrange in the corresponding room of the new house.

Nika did a good job summarizing the two ways to get a home. The thing to remember on the premium plus homes is that everyone has the same ability to ticket a desirable location, so you may not get the one you want... someone may beat you to it. For that reason it is good to list multiple choices on a ticket.. you are only allowed 3 tickets for every 30 days. So do something like 1st choice, 2nd choice, 3rd choice, 4th choice.

Or you can log on to the land page and choose a theme. If you dont like the location they give you, you can always abandon it and choose another one. You get up to 5 choices every 24 hours. At the moment as I write this, there are 39 ranch homes and 47 mediterranean homes available. That is a lot of places, so hopefully you will land a location you like within your first day's allotted tries (we call them "rolls").

When I move from one house to another, I typically have little collections or rooms of collections that I want to be able to find without sorting through my inventory to find each object. So I've developed a little system. I first rez a prim in the center of the room and name it something that identifies that grouping for me. For example, I may rez a prim in the middle of my kitchen. So I will name the prim kitchen with a date and the name of the house style. Ex. -> kitchen, 4.2.24, houseboat shorething. Then I will target each object in the kitchen targeting the named prim last and pick up the whole thing. I repeat that process for all the rooms in the house. I then drop all of these coalesced objects into a folder named appropriately so I know which house and time frame the items were picked up. I've done this so many times now that my folder of "picked up stuff from houses" is quite full. It really does help me to find groupings I've made in the past and want to reuse. 

One thing to remember if you use this little system, you might not want to include no copy items.
